Immenso, occhi bendati alla cieca Team Brothers Sobokki Boloan Raja Ram Buriband. - Mendicante 0 Gr., Bhat 02, pagina 32 अंधधुंध १ संज्ञा पुं० [सं० अन्ध = अन्धकार + धुम = धुआँ अथवा अंन्ध +
धुनन (कंपन हलचल), सं० अन्ध + हिं० धुंध]
१. अंधकार ।
अँधेरा । उ०—(क) अति विपरीत तृणावर्त आयो । बातचक्र
मिस ब्रज के ऊपर नंद पँवरि से भीतर आयो । अंधधुंध भयो
सब गोकुल जो जहाँ रह्यो सो तहाँ छयायो ।—सुर०, (शब्द०) ।
(ख) काउलै ओट रहत वृक्षन की अंधक्षुंध दिसि बिदिसि
भुलाने ।—सुर०, १० ।८६०. ।. २. अंधाधुंध । अंधेर । अनरंति ।
दुराचर । अनियमित व्यापार । उच्छृंखल कर्म । उ०—समुझि
न परै तिहारी मधुकर, हम ब्रजनारि गँवार । सुरदास ऐसी
क्यों निब अंधधुंध सरकार ।—सुर०, १० ।३९०९ ।
अंधधुंध २ वि०
विशाल । अपार ।उ.— देखत मदंध दसकंध अंधधुंध
दल बंधु सों बलकि बोल्यों राजा राम बरिबंड ।—भिखारी०
ग्रं०, भा०२, पृ० ३२ ।
